Cosi Swimsuit and Raglan Rash Guard

sophie3.2

The Cosi Swimsuit by SewPony Vintage has been on my to-sew list for ages.

sophie5.2

A quick google search will bring up countless darling versions and will give you the itch to sew one up too.

sophie2

I love all the options it comes with- two piece or one piece and multiple color blocking choices plus a version with a ruched center piece.  They all are so retro and cute!

sophie1

I did the view F bottoms and added faux piping in the seams.  For the top, I used the one piece pattern and chopped it off to hit as close to the top of the bottoms as I could.  I wanted the look of the two piece with the modesty of a one piece.

sophie4.2

We have so many versions planned come summer!  It’s a fantastic pattern with great instructions and so, so many options.

sophie8

We also adore rash guards and I love how simple they are to make.

sophie6

I used the Recess Raglan from See Kate Sew.  I take it in under the arms a bit to be more fitted and line the front in swimsuit lining.

sophie9

So perfect for hitting the waves!

sophiecoverup

To finish her look, she got a new cover-up.  I used the Kelli Kimono from Made for Mermaids.  I followed my women’s version (the Patterns for Pirates Summer Kimono) as a guide to make it robe length and to add a sash sewn onto the back.  It’s out of a lightweight sweater knit that matches her suit perfectly!

A Christmas Jane Dress

jane1

After many tears over this dress not fitting, I promised to make it up to my Payton.  I let her pick the fabric from my stash and she picked this super soft flannel shirting from my stash.  I knew it needed to be a simple sweet a-line dress and the Jane Dress from Shwin Designs would be perfect.

jane3

I had made a sweet summery version with a collar during testing of this pattern and decided to leave off the collar and add a detachable one this time.

jane6

I used Made for Mermaids FREE Tiffany Collar in black lace and I love the look and the fact that she can wear it with other things.

jane5

I added pom pom trim to all the hems for a little pizazz.  I just adore this cute, classic little dress.
